It’s easy to think a GPT is working well when you cherry-pick a few good responses. But the real test? Seeing how it performs across different users, scenarios, and requests. That’s where benchmarks come in. The course also introduced me to the CAPITAL Framework which helps measure key areas like accuracy, precision, adaptability, and clarity. One of my favorite assignments? Building a custom GPT to generate test cases for your custom GPTs. Seems ironic, however, super useful in helping you define rubrics to measure the outputs.
